        The conversation between Sharon (Athena) and Adama from the late second season comes to mind. He asks her why. She then refers to the speech that Adama gave in the miniseries. Why does the human race deserve to survive? Maybe they don't. Which brings me to my main point...

        Baltar is a goat. They basically torture him for what the Cylons did on New Caprica because they can't come to terms with it themselves and need someone to blame. I'm not championing Baltar or anything he has done by any means, but what went on the the last episode was cruel and inhumane. I found myself hating Roslin, Tigh, and Adama for what they were doing out of fear and misplaced hatred. As far as Roslin goes I generally lie the character, but I would love to see her knocked off her high moral ground when she finds out that she in't the dying leader of prophecy who leads the way to Earth and that maybe Baltar is... that would be humorous to say the least. None of the characters have been very likeable lately (let's not even get started on the whole Lee/Dee/Kara/Anders fiasco) and I think there's a reason for it. It just has to play out.
